スマホゲーム開発学習本おすすめ6選【入門者〜上級者までレベル別に紹介】


自分のレベルに合わせたスマホゲーム開発の参考本が欲しい!
読みながら理解してスマホゲームを開発できるかな?

スマホゲームの開発にトライしたい、さらなるスキルを高めたいなど、人によってゲーム作りのスタート地点が異なります。

そこでここでは、

初級・中級・上級者向けにスマホゲーム開発のオススメ参考図書を6冊ご紹介します。

今まで挫折した方でも、レベルや目的に沿ってレッスンすればオリジナルのスマホゲームを完成できます。毎日学びながらステップアップでき、難点も自分で解決しながらゲームをクリエイトできるでしょう。

スマホゲームの開発は、これからもどんどん需要が大きくなる分野です。ゲームプログラマーを夢見る方、すでにエキスパートの方も、ぜひ楽しいスマホゲーム作りに役立ててください。

目次

初心者向け

Unity2019入門

編集部コメント

初心者でもUnityを簡単に操作しながら、スマホゲーム作りができる本です。ダウンロードからゲーム作りまで、丁寧なステップで紹介されています。プログラミング言語を知らなくても、必要な技術は基礎から教えてくれるので安心です。

単にテキストを読むだけでなく、サンプルを参考にしながらより良い学習ができます。手を動かしながら学習できるので、手応えを確かめながら進めることができます。複雑なコードを書く必要がなく、気軽にゲーム作りをスタートできる参考書です。

おすすめポイント
  • Unityではじめてゲームを作るときにぜひ読んでほしい一冊

  • 初心者でも挫折しないよう丁寧に解説している

  • 2D・3Dゲームのサンプルコードを動かしながら学べる

 

Unityの教科書

編集部コメント

ゼロからスマホゲーム作りを始めたい方のUnity入門書です。わかりやすい図解で理解も早いです。

C#言語の基本的なコードもレッスンできるので、一冊でゲーム作りをスタートできます。途中でつまずくような高いハードルもなく、スムーズな学習が可能です。

すぐに試せるサンプルがあるので、初心者でもゲームを作るコツがつかみやすいでしょう。自信をつけながらマイペースでレベルアップもでき、効率良い学習ができます。初歩から応用まで、Unityスマホゲーム作りの悩みを解決してくれます。

おすすめポイント
  • ゼロからスマホゲームを作りたい人向けの入門書

  • 操作手順は画像で解説しているので、初心者でもわかりやすい

  • C#言語の基礎的なコードも学べる

 

中級者向け

Unityゲーム プログラミング・バイブル

編集部コメント

Unityの基礎を学んだ方が取り掛かりやすい教本です。C#言語サンプルが記載されているので、中級のレベルに入ったばかりの方でも楽しみながら学習できます。

Unity本来の機能を試すテクニックが満載されており、プロへの一歩を踏み出せるでしょう。

レベルが上がるにつれ説明が書き言葉になる傾向がありますが、画像が豊富に挿入されているのでリズムよく解釈できます。他にどんなコードがあるのか知識を増やしたい、スマホゲーム開発を深く学習したい方にも最適です。

おすすめポイント
  • Unityの基礎を学んだ人がレベルアップしたいときに読んでほしい

  • すでにお仕事している人にもおすすめの一冊

  • C#のサンプルコードや画像が豊富で効率的に学習が進められる

 

Unityではじめる2Dゲーム作り

編集部コメント

すでにC#言語の知識がある方に取り掛かりやすい教本です。2Dスマホゲームに使用される基本的なアクションプログラムが豊富に説明されています。サンプル例もたくさんあるので、細かな動きが実際にどのようなコードで動くのかわかりやすいです。

またゲームプログラムのほかにも、Unityの詳しい操作法やユーザーが操作するスマホ上のパッドなども説明しており、充実した内容になっています。スマホゲームの開発経験がある方でも一度読むとプラスアルファの知識が得られる参考書となるでしょう。

おすすめポイント
  • 2Dのスマホゲームを自由に作れるレベルのノウハウを解説している

  • 基本操作のアクションプログラムが豊富

  • カメラ利用などUnityでスマホを操作する方法が幅広く学べる

 

上級者向け

Unityの寺子屋

編集部コメント

基本的なC#言語やUnityの習得を前提としたスマホゲーム教本です。サンプルはシンプルな構造になっているので、プロがおさらいしたいときも良い参考になります。段取りを追って解説されており、関心のある部分を素早く勉強できるのもメリットです。

込み入ったテキストの説明もあり、入門書と比べてワンランクアップのスキル試しができます。試行錯誤を繰り返しながら、オリジナルのスマホゲームをどんどん開発できるでしょう。完成したアプリの配信方法や広告バナー付けに悩んでいるときも、この本で解決です。

おすすめポイント
  • C#やUnityの技術向上におすすめの一冊

  • 画像が豊富でわかりやすい

  • 広告導入の注意事項などのスマホゲームを運用する時のノウハウも解説している

 

つくりながら覚えるスマホゲームプログラミング

編集部コメント

Monaca」を使ってスマホゲームを開発する中級者向けの参考書です。多彩なゲームの作成に挑戦しながら、豊富なテクニックを学習できます。さらにゲームの基盤となるデータベースなどの習得も解説しているので、プロの方にも読み応えのある本です。

与えられたサンプルのプログラムに止まらず、自由にプログラムを変更しながら応用するスキルを身につけられます。すでに「Monaca」でスマホゲーム作りに慣れている、機能を充実させたい方に、より本格的なゲーム作りをサポートしてくれるでしょう。

おすすめポイント
  • 「Monaca」を使ったスマホゲームの作り方が学べる

  • ゲーム作りに必要なエッセンスが凝縮されているので、テンポよく進められる

  • HTML、CSS、JavaScriptの勉強にもなる

 

まとめ

初級・中級・上級者向けにスマホゲーム開発のオススメ参考図書を6冊ご紹介しました。

今までは遊ぶ立場だった方も多いスマホゲームですが、開発もさらにハマるものですよ。最初はつまずいていた部分も、それぞれのレベルに合った本を参考にすれば効率良いスマホゲーム作りができます。

大切なことはスマホゲームを作る情熱を持ち続けること。決して先を急がず、一つずつ理解しながら素晴らしいゲームプログラマーを目指してください。

この記事を書いた人

【プロフィール】
DX認定取得事業者に選定されている株式会社SAMURAIのマーケティング・コミュニケーション部が運営。「質の高いIT教育を、すべての人に」をミッションに、IT・プログラミングを学び始めた初学者の方に向け記事を執筆。
累計指導者数4万5,000名以上のプログラミングスクール「侍エンジニア」、累計登録者数1万8,000人以上のオンライン学習サービス「侍テラコヤ」で扱う教材開発のノウハウ、2013年の創業から運営で得た知見に基づき、記事の執筆だけでなく編集・監修も担当しています。
【専門分野】
IT/Web開発/AI・ロボット開発/インフラ開発/ゲーム開発/AI/Webデザイン

目次